This Processing Path of Unrefined Soybean Oil
The transformation of raw soybean oil is a lengthy procedure, involving several crucial phases. Initially, the soybeans are cleaned and shelled to remove any impurities. Subsequently, the soybeans undergo extraction—either mechanical pressing to yield oil or a solvent extraction technique using a solvent. The resulting crude oil then enters a purification sequence. This typically includes degumming, to eliminate phospholipids; neutralization, which deals with free fatty acids; bleaching, to lighten the oil; and deodorization, addressing odor and taste compounds.
